The Circus Of Varieties

Season: 4 Episode: 29

An unassuming building in the centre of Bristol was host to some of the greatest entertainers Europe had to offer. It was the site of a very popular past time and regularly had major exhibitions and balls. It even played a part in the development of the area's aviation industry, but you wouldn't think it now.

Listen to the story of a building now called 'University Gate', but was famous as 'The Circus of Varieties'.
